Dual-fuel ethane carrier “Navigator Aurora” delivered

Shipping company Navigator Gas said it has recently taken the delivery of its dual-fuel ethane carrier Navigator Aurora.

The Navigator Aurora was delivered to the owner at Jiangnan Shipyard in Shanghai, China on August 2.

According to Navigator Gas, the ethane carrier is capable to sail both on diesel fuel and liquefied natural gas (LNG).

With a length of 180 m, the newly-built Navigator Aurora has a total cargo tank size of 35,000 cbm and can hold ethane loads of up to 20,000 tonnes, making it the “biggest ethane-capable vessel serving the global market,” according to Navigator Gas.

The Navigator Aurora has been chartered for a minimum of 10 years to the European chemical group Borealis to transport ethane from the U.S. East Coast to Europe, with commercial operations scheduled to begin in the fourth quarter of 2016.
